Lines Matching refs:reg
32 volatile unsigned char status1_82077; /* Auxiliary Status reg. 1 */
33 volatile unsigned char status2_82077; /* Auxiliary Status reg. 2 */
34 volatile unsigned char dor_82077; /* Digital Output reg. */
35 volatile unsigned char tapectl_82077; /* Tape Control reg */
37 #define drs_82077 status_82077 /* Digital Rate Select reg. */
40 volatile unsigned char dir_82077; /* Digital Input reg. */
41 #define dcr_82077 dir_82077 /* Config Control reg. */
50 unsigned char (*fd_inb) (unsigned long port, unsigned int reg);
52 unsigned int reg);
66 #define fd_inb(base, reg) sun_fdops.fd_inb(base, reg)
67 #define fd_outb(value, base, reg) sun_fdops.fd_outb(value, base, reg)
101 static unsigned char sun_82077_fd_inb(unsigned long base, unsigned int reg)
104 switch (reg) {
106 printk("floppy: Asked to read unknown port %x\n", reg);
120 unsigned int reg)
123 switch (reg) {
125 printk("floppy: Asked to write to unknown port %x\n", reg);
303 static unsigned char sun_pci_fd_inb(unsigned long base, unsigned int reg)
306 return inb(base + reg);
310 unsigned int reg)
313 outb(val, base + reg);
317 unsigned int reg)
327 if (reg == FD_DOR) {
332 outb(val, base + reg);
337 unsigned int reg)
347 if (reg == FD_DOR) {
353 outb(val, base + reg);
452 unsigned long reg)
459 outb(val, reg);